Pēdējā Google I / O laikā Google ir skaidri norādījis, ka Java vairs nebūs galvenā Android programmēšanas valoda dodiet ceļu citām valodām, piemēram, Python vai Kotlin. Python instalēšana Ubuntu nav nepieciešama, jo tā jau ir Ubuntu izplatīšanā, bet Un kotlins? Kā Kotlin var instalēt Ubuntu? Vai to ir viegli izdarīt?
Kotlin var ne tikai instalēt operētājsistēmā Windows vai MacOS, bet arī instalēt operētājsistēmās, kuru pamatā ir UNIX, ieskaitot Ubuntu un atvasinājumus.
Kotlin ir bezmaksas programmēšanas valoda, kas pieejama, izmantojot oficiālajā vietnē projekta. Lai to izdarītu, mums ir jālejupielādē tikai jaunākā Kotlin versija un jāatsaiņo tā mūsu Ubuntu. Tas ir vienkāršs process, taču tā sastādīšana var radīt problēmas. Tādējādi vislabāk ir izvēlēties instalēšanas skriptus. Mums vienkārši jāatver terminālis un jāuzraksta sekojošais:
curl -s https://get.sdkman.io | bash
Pēc tam veiciet instalēšanu ar šādu komandu:
sdk install kotlin
Tagad mūsu Ubuntu jau ir Kotlin valoda. Bet vai tas ir viss?
Kā izveidot programmu Kotlinā
Patiesība ir tāda, ka nē. Tas mums ļaus kompilēt Kotlin kodu, bet neveidot failus. Lai izveidotu failus, mēs varam izmantojiet kodu redaktorus vai tieši IDE, ko mēs varam instalēt Ubuntu. Kad kods ir uzrakstīts, mēs to saglabājam paplašinājums .kt un mēs atveram termināli tajā pašā vietā, kur izveidots fails. Tagad terminālā mēs rakstām:
kotlinc ARCHIVO-CODIGO.kt -include-runtime -d ARCHIVO-CODIGO.jar
Ubuntu apkopos failu un izveidos izpildāmo failu, kas izmanto Java virtuālo mašīnu, kaut ko jau esam instalējuši Ubuntu. Tātad, pateicoties šīm vienkāršajām darbībām, mēs varam instalēt un palaist jebkuru kodu, kas rakstīts Kotlina valodai. Ja mēs izmantojam Android Studio, Kotlin instalēšana ir vēl vienkāršāka, jo mums vienkārši jāatrod atbilstošais spraudnis un tas jāinstalē, izmantojot Google IDE.
Labi, es nesaprotu rakstu, vispirms jūs sakāt šo (es citēju):
"Pēdējā Google I / O laikā Google ir skaidri norādījis, ka Java vairs nebūs galvenā Android programmēšanas valoda, lai dotu vietu citām valodām, piemēram, Python vai Kotlin."
Un tad jūs sakāt šo (es citēju):
"Ubuntu apkopos failu un izveidos izpildāmo failu, kas izmanto Java virtuālo mašīnu, kaut ko jau esam instalējuši Ubuntu."
Lūdzu, vai jūs varētu man palīdzēt neskaidrībās? Paldies!
Java ir valoda, kuras kods ir sastādīts, lai palaistu Java virtuālajā mašīnā. Kotlin ir vēl viena valoda ar atšķirīgām īpašībām, kas arī ir apkopota, lai palaistu Java virtuālajā mašīnā.
Ir trīs jēdzieni: Java virtuālā mašīna, Java valoda un Ktolin valoda